Maternal warmth serves as the foundation of a child's emotional and social development. Children who grow up in environments of consistent, nurturing care are significantly more likely to develop robust emotional resilience and strong social skills. The impact of a mother's warmth isn't limited to feelings; it has a tangible and profound effect on the psychological development of a child. It's a critical component in the formation of a secure attachment style, the ability to regulate emotions, and the development of cognitive abilities. Supported by scientific findings from reputable institutions like the American Psychological Association, the concept shows the intricate mechanisms at play.
- Secure Attachment and Emotional Security: A nurturing mother provides the safety and trust that children need.
- Emotional Regulation: Maternal warmth helps kids manage their emotions effectively and develop coping mechanisms.
- Social Skills and Adaptability: Children with nurturing mothers are generally better at social interaction and adapt to changes.
